Amending "People, Planet, Profit"

Amending “People, Planet, Profit”

The phrase “People, Planet, Profit”  - coined by author John Elkington – promotes the idea for businesses to succeed in a number of different ways, rather than the traditional ‘bottom line’. Elkington’s Triple Bottom Line brought on a reluctant swell of Corporate Social Responsibility – the idea that corporations should embrace the TBL to benefit...
